Mothers' Instinct (2018 film)

Mothers' Instinct () is a 2018 Belgian psychological thriller film directed by Olivier Masset-Depasse. The story is loosely based on the 2012 novel Behind the Hatred (Derrière la haine) by Barbara Abel. The film was screened as a special presentation at the 2018 Toronto International Film Festival.

It received ten nominations at the 10th Magritte Awards, winning nine, including Best Film and Best Director for Masset-Depasse, setting the record for the most Magritte Awards won by a single film. It was later overtaken by Night Call (2025), which won ten awards.
